  1. It's not bad, it's sure got the looks and sounds great too especially now that I've bypassed the centre exhaust resonator. 

    Personally I believe the "M" version is the best option having 343bhp over the 3.0si's more civilised 265bhp, but it's mostly wasted as the 0-60 time only comes down from 5.3 Sec to 5.0 Sec, thus making it not quite worth the £7000 premium over the price of a 3.0si.

    So far, it's my favourite out of all the cars I've owned :)
